This takes days to unpack properly but I'm VERY happy with the result. Underlying profit is a little lower than I was expecting but that is due to less apartment sales than I anticipated. I was hoping Awatere would have finished before FY cut off but It appears not ( Hamilton contributed no sales therefore it wasn't ready before year end.) This is no biggie as the new sales just happen this FY.
The number I said was the most key to the whole OCA model working ( as in decent future profit growth)is village DMF, and they knocked that out of the park.
When you consider 3 months of the year was in some form of lockdown, they repaid the 1.8m wage subsidy and direct covid costs were $2.5m I think it is actually a very credible result. All the KPIs I outlined earlier this week have hit the mark.
Look at those new build margins , not a sign of reducing. In fact the first half margins were 26% while HY2 was 30%. (the average is as per the reported annual 28%. )
So at first brush...a very solid result and things are bang on track. Watching the share action this morning it appears no one knows what to make of this result yet but I suspect over the weekend the analysts will be beavering away and come back next week with a big thumbs up.
